What is Fueling Up?
So, what exactly does it mean to fuel up your EV? Simply put, fueling up refers to the process of replenishing your car's battery with electrical energy. This can be done through various methods, including charging at home, public charging stations, or even on-the-go via DC Fast Charging.
When you plug in your EV, the charging cable transfers energy from the power source to your car's battery, which stores this energy until it's needed to power your vehicle.
The Kilowatt Breakdown
Understanding kilowatt (kW) and its relevance to EV charging is crucial for anyone looking to fuel up their car. Kilowatts measure the rate at which electrical energy is transferred to your car's battery.
For example, a 50 kW charging station would deliver 50 kilowatts of energy to your car's battery every hour. This means that if your car has a 50 kWh battery, it would take 1 hour to fully charge at that rate.
Types of EV Charging
There are several types of EV charging, each with its own unique characteristics and benefits. Let's take a closer look at the three main types:
- This is the most common type of charging, where drivers plug their EV into a standard household outlet. Level 1 charging uses a standard 120V outlet and typically takes 12-24 hours to fully charge a car.
- Level 2 charging requires a 240V charging station and uses a specialized charging cable. This type of charging typically takes 4-8 hours to fully charge a car, depending on the battery size.
- This is the fastest type of charging, using extremely high-powered charging stations that can deliver up to 350 kW of energy. DC Fast Charging can top up your battery to 80% in just 30 minutes.
Charging at Home
One of the most convenient ways to fuel up your EV is at home. With a Level 2 charging station installed, you can charge your car overnight while you sleep, waking up to a fully charged battery every morning.
Not only is home charging convenient, but it's also cost-effective. With an increasing number of utilities offering special EV rates, you can save money on your electricity bill while charging your car.
